typedef struct _Py_DebugOffsets {
// Runtime state offset;
off_t rs_finalizing;
off_t rs_interpreters_head;

// Interpreter state offset;
off_t is_next;
off_t is_threads_head;
off_t is_gc;
off_t is_imports_modules;
off_t is_sysdict;
off_t is_builtins;
off_t is_ceval_gil;

// Thread state offset;
off_t ts_prev;
off_t ts_next;
off_t ts_interp;
off_t ts_cframe;
off_t ts_thread_id;

// Frame object offset;
off_t fo_previous;
off_t fo_executable;
off_t fo_prev_instr;
off_t fo_localsplus;
off_t fo_owner;

// Code object offset;
off_t co_filename;
off_t co_name;
off_t co_linetable;
off_t co_firstlineno;
off_t co_argcount;
off_t co_localsplusnames;
off_t co_co_code_adaptive;
} _Py_DebugOffsets;

/* Full Python runtime state */

/* _PyRuntimeState holds the global state for the CPython runtime.
That data is exposed in the internal API as a static variable (_PyRuntime).
*/
typedef struct pyruntimestate {
/* This field must be first to facilitate locating it by out of process
* debuggers. Out of process debuggers will use the offsets contained in this
* field to be able to locate other fields in several interpreter structures
* in a way that doesn't require them to know the exact layout of those
* structures */
_Py_DebugOffsets debug_offsets;

A new debug structure of offsets has been added to the ``_PyRuntimeState``
that will help out-of-process debuggers and profilers to obtain the offsets
to relevant interpreter structures in a way that is agnostic of how Python
was compiled and that doesn't require copying the headers. Patch by Pablo
Galindo
